It's where you agree to the terms and conditions of your employment laid out in the offer letter. You can include details like your: job title. start date. salary (optional)

How To Write A Job Offer Acceptance Letter? Review your job offer. Add date at the top. Include your name and address. Include the recipient's name and address. Add a subject line. Add a salutation. Express gratitude for the offer. Accept the offer and terms of employment.

Acceptance Letter Format I am writing to confirm my acceptance of your employment offer from April 1. I am delighted to be joining International Engineering Corporation as a Project Manager. The work is exactly what I have prepared for and hoped to do.

How to write a letter of acceptance Address the letter to the recruiter. Express your gratitude for the offer. Confirm the terms of employment. Format your letter appropriately. Proofread your letter. Send your letter and follow up with the recruiter.

You might say something like, "I am writing to kindly request an official acceptance letter for the internship program. Receiving this letter would help me confirm my spot, and it would be helpful to have a formal record of my acceptance for my personal files."

Begin the letter by expressing your excitement and gratitude for being offered the position. For example, ``I am pleased to accept the (job title) position with (Company Name).'' Confirm the details of the job offer, such as the job title, start date, salary, and any other key terms that were discussed.

Dear (Employer's Name), Thank you for offering me the position of (Job Title) at (Company Name). I am delighted and grateful to accept this offer and I look forward to joining your team. I appreciate the opportunity you have given me to work with such a reputable and respected organization.
